About the role

As a Lead Concept Artist at Fortis Games, you will work closely with the Art Director to help conceptualize the visual style of our mobile games. You’ll bring your expertise as a visionary, designer, and storyteller to lead a global team of passionate artists to visually communicate and maintain a stylized art direction throughout the creation of world-class environments, characters, props, and key art marketing materials.

What you’ll achieve

  • Collaborate with the Art Director to establish and execute the artistic vision of a game.
  • Create designs for characters, creatures, props, and environments to elevate the gameplay and overall player experience.
  • Gather and catalog references, conduct competitive analysis, and formulate research strategies under the lead of the Art Director.
  • Understand and evangelize the visual style of the game, sharing knowledge with the team to ensure that the vision and directions are clear and understandable.
  • Collaborate with other leads and team members across various departments to problem-solve and help steer the conceptual direction into the final game experience.
  • Lead the Concept Art team, guiding other artists through both mentorship and constructive critique.
  • Schedule, prioritize and monitor tasks for your team.
  • Work closely with the Design, 3D Asset, Environment, and Character teams, joining their design processes and resolving visual problems that arise during production.
  • Benchmark quality assets covering all aspects of style guides, creative briefs, concept design, key art, illustration, and experiments adhering to the overall art direction.
  • A visual style that has broad appeal while being distinct and memorable. We aspire for our original IP to have the potential to cross over into multiple games, genres, and media.
  • A well-led team of artists who feel informed, challenged, and supported to do their best work.
  • An efficient and scalable art pipeline that can provide a foundation for future games shaped by constructive feedback and implemented solutions.

What you’ll need to be successful

  • Outstanding 2D drawing skills and a good aesthetic sense with a solid understanding of how concepts translate into 3D game assets. 
  • Top-notch technique and thorough knowledge of anatomy, perspective, composition, color theory, shape language, mood and tone and textures.
  • Solid understanding of technical constraints, and terminology.
  • Mastery of industry-standard digital painting tools such as Photoshop 
  • Ability to turn ideas into images, coupled with a desire to push the envelope.
  • A portfolio showcasing a range in styles that leans heavily towards stylized work.
  • Commitment to the project and a desire to find the best possible way of inspiring others.
  • Ability to communicate your creative vision, process, decisions, and rationale to team members and cross-functional stakeholders in a way that inspires and motivates.
  • Enthusiasm for directing, mentoring, and otherwise elevating the people around you to do their best work.
  • A natural curiosity and eagerness to learn - we believe this is essential to our ability to stay ahead of the market and value this over years of experience.
  • We expect our leaders to continue being students of their craft and the game spaces they’re working in.
  • You should be aware of the latest trends and have a strong perspective on how they relate to our current and future projects.
  • Have deep experience as a concept artist in games and/or related industries
